The Alert Avalanche Problem
Let’s start with the elephant in the SOC: alert fatigue. When your security team is buried under a mountain of notifications—most of them false positives—it’s easy to miss the one that actually matters. And when teams are constantly reacting, they’re rarely analyzing, improving, or getting ahead of threats. That’s not sustainable.
False positives don’t just waste time—they cost money. MSPs often measure efficiency by how many endpoints they can protect per technician. If a team is spending hours chasing down benign alerts, that ratio suffers. It’s a lose-lose situation: clients feel under protected, and your team feels burned out.

More Value from Your Existing Stack
One of the lesser-discussed advantages of automated malware analysis is how it helps MSPs extract more value from their current security investments. Your EDR, SIEM, firewall, and antivirus solutions are all generating data. With automation, those tools can talk to each other and share context, turning raw signals into actionable insights.
For example, if a suspicious file is detected by an endpoint tool, an automated system can submit it for malware analysis, cross-check threat intelligence feeds, and suggest firewall rules to prevent future risk in real-time. What would have taken hours (or days) now happens in minutes.
Doing More With Less
Many MSPs face the same staffing challenge: how do you scale security services without scaling payroll? Automation is the answer. By reducing manual effort, even small teams can deliver enterprise-grade security. This makes it easier to offer premium services like threat hunting, advanced malware analysis, or compliance reporting—without hiring an army of analysts.
It also means you can protect more clients with the same team, increasing profitability while maintaining high service standards.
